The congregation at Emmanuel joined with Trinity in the building of the parish hall, named Stuart Hall, in 1957 and services were no longer held in Sperryville after that point. In 1957, church membership reached 84.

The parish hall was expanded in 1986, to provide more room for church and community activities and church offices. The new addition was named Bromfield Hall at a dedication by Rt. Rev. Peter James Lee, Bishop of the Diocese of Virginia.

Within the last year, gardens have been added on church property. They have also purchased the house across the street, and are renovating it to use for educational purposes. Today, Trinity has approximately 200 active adult members.

Services are held at Trinity Episcopal Church every Sunday morning, and presided over by Rev. Jennings W. Hobson, III.
